This dataset and reproducibility package supports a city-scale assessment of climate-sensitive native pavement-subgrade vulnerability in Edmonton, Alberta. It contains processed soil, groundwater, terrain, freeze-thaw and vulnerability data for 213 hydrogeological cases representing 198 weighted locations across five Edmonton zones. Four climate pathways (SSP1-2.6, SSP2-4.5, SSP3-7.0 and SSP5-8.5) and 25 soil-property realizations were evaluated, producing 21,300 case-pathway realizations at CBR-equivalent screening thresholds of 3%, 4% and 5%.The package includes groundwater evidence and decision tables, spatial-validation diagnostics, case-level uncertainty summaries, publication figures, model code, figure-generation scripts, expected benchmark outputs, data provenance, software requirements and SHA-256 checksums. Raw externally governed climate, well, terrain and geological products are not redistributed; their official sources and access requirements are documented. The archive supports reproduction of the reported tables, figures and summary metrics without rerunning the complete climate-to-subgrade simulations.
